Subject: [PATCH 5/5] usb: otg: twl4030: fix cold plug on OMAP3

Having twl4030_usb_phy_init() (detects if a cable is connected before
twl4030 is probed) in twl4030 probe makes cable connect events to be
missed by musb glue, since it gets loaded after twl4030. Having
twl4030_usb_phy_init as a usb_phy ops lets twl4030_usb_phy_init to be
called when glue is ready.

Signed-off-by: Kishon Vijay Abraham I <kishon@ti.com>
---
 drivers/usb/otg/twl4030-usb.c |    7 ++++---
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/usb/otg/twl4030-usb.c b/drivers/usb/otg/twl4030-usb.c
index 5b20bb4..4040124 100644
--- a/drivers/usb/otg/twl4030-usb.c
+++ b/drivers/usb/otg/twl4030-usb.c
@@ -565,8 +565,9 @@ static void twl4030_id_workaround_work(struct work_struct *work)
 	}
 }
 
-static void twl4030_usb_phy_init(struct twl4030_usb *twl)
+static int twl4030_usb_phy_init(struct usb_phy *phy)
 {
+	struct twl4030_usb *twl = phy_to_twl(phy);
 	enum omap_musb_vbus_id_status status;
 
 	/*
@@ -581,6 +582,7 @@ static void twl4030_usb_phy_init(struct twl4030_usb *twl)
 		omap_musb_mailbox(twl->linkstat);
 
 	sysfs_notify(&twl->dev->kobj, NULL, "vbus");
+	return 0;
 }
 
 static int twl4030_set_suspend(struct usb_phy *x, int suspend)
@@ -657,6 +659,7 @@ static int twl4030_usb_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	twl->phy.otg		= otg;
 	twl->phy.type		= USB_PHY_TYPE_USB2;
 	twl->phy.set_suspend	= twl4030_set_suspend;
+	twl->phy.init		= twl4030_usb_phy_init;
 
 	otg->phy		= &twl->phy;
 	otg->set_host		= twl4030_set_host;
@@ -696,8 +699,6 @@ static int twl4030_usb_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 		return status;
 	}
 
-	twl4030_usb_phy_init(twl);
-
 	dev_info(&pdev->dev, "Initialized TWL4030 USB module\n");
 	return 0;
 }
